I live about an hour and a half from the dragon, and have never had any run ins with the law. I tend to try to ride a fairly constant speed, and just not slow down much for the turns. I brake in and power out, but I don't tend to run through as many gears as I can before the next turn. There are many turns where you really don't want to be going over about 25 mph when you get into it. If you go out, hit some turns hard, and stay in your lane, the cops tend to leave you alone. If you are going 10/10ths through all the turns, late braking, and trying to get all of the speed you can eek out on the sraights (the "straights" is used very loosely in this case), you are probably going to have a bad time if you run into the law. Oh, the Skyway and the Blue ridge parkway are great as well. Not as intense, but a fun ride.
